ArcelorMital threatened Ukrzaliznytsia by a claim due to a change in freight tariff

Changing freight tariffs, Ukrzaliznytsia abuses a monopoly position, and its decisions are artificial and groundless. This was stated by ArcelorMittal Kryvyi Rih (AMCR), which is the largest foreign investor in Ukraine.
They also stated that they were ready to contact the Antimonopoly Committee to understand the situation.
The reason is that the UZ formed new trains for the plant to the Odessa port. And now they will have to go 257 km more – which, accordingly, will cost much more. Moreover, these changes – artificial and unfounded, say in AMC.
“We consider any manifestations of abuse of a monopoly position and are ready to contact the Antimonopoly Committee of Ukraine on this occasion,” – said Alexander Bilyansky, Deputy CEO for the supply of Arcelormittal Kryvyi Rih.
